Motorized LWIR lenses for cooled cameras are advanced optical devices that offer adjustable focal lengths and variable field of view. These lenses are controlled electronically, allowing for precise adjustments during operation.
Fixed lenses are optical devices with a set focal length, providing a consistent field of view. They are simpler in design and are often used in applications where variable adjustments are not necessary.
| Feature | Motorized LWIR Lenses | Fixed Lenses |
|---|---|---|
| Adjustability | High | None |
| Cost | Higher | Lower |
| Ease of Use | Requires training | User-friendly |
| Battery Life | Variable | N/A |
| Stability | High | Very High |
The battery life of motorized LWIR lenses can vary significantly based on usage patterns and operational settings, which necessitates planning for extended operations compared to fixed lenses that do not require power.
Fixed lenses generally offer higher stability due to their simpler design, while motorized lenses provide adaptability, which can introduce slight variability in certain conditions.
Motorized LWIR lenses are ideal for applications requiring adaptability and modern integration, such as surveillance and robotics. On the other hand, fixed lenses are best suited for stable environments where constant parameters are maintained, like industrial imaging systems.
In conclusion, choosing between motorized LWIR lenses for cooled cameras and fixed lenses depends largely on the specific needs of the application.
